ANN ARBOR — A Michigan animal shelter is asking for the public’s help after a passerby found an emaciated dog on the side of an Ann Arbor road.
The Humane Society of Huron Valley reported in a news release that the dog was brought in on Sunday, July 21st, after it was found covered in urine and feces near the intersection of Chalmers Drive and Washtenaw Avenue.
The dog, which staff have named Chickadee, is roughly 5 years old and is a bulldog mix…
